New build house with energy efficient screed in Llangollen
This project involved the construction of a new, self-sufficient residential property in Llangollen, designed to operate with a strong focus on energy efficiency and long-term performance. A key requirement was the integration of an air source heat pump (ASHP) with an underfloor heating (UFH) system, supported by a Gypsol Zero Laitance (ZL) screed solution capable of maximising heat transfer while enabling a fast construction programme.

The challenge
The homeowner required a screed solution specifically designed for use with underfloor heating and compatible with a low-energy ASHP system. Fast heat transfer, rapid drying, and minimal follow-on works were critical to maintaining programme efficiency and enabling early installation of the final floor finish.
In addition, the project team required a screed that would perform reliably without introducing unnecessary remedial works, such as surface laitance removal, which can add time and cost to residential builds.
The solution
Gypsol ZL was chosen for this project because it does not require laitance removal. This allowed for faster installation, accelerated drying times and proven performance with UFH systems.
Gypsol ZL offers excellent flow and consistency, while supporting rapid progression to the final floor finish, all while remaining a cement-free, low-carbon solution. A total of 11.3m³ of Gypsol ZL was installed across the 172m² property.
Installation and application
The Gypsol ZL screed arrived on site fully within specification and was laid to a high-quality finish. The material set and cured as expected, with no laitance present on the surface, removing the need for sanding or additional preparation works.
The air source heat pump and underfloor heating system were installed by specialist contractor Niche Energy Solutions. Gypsol ZL was supplied by Holcim Readymix (Eco-Readymix) and was pumped directly into the building and finished using standard dapple techniques to achieve the required surface quality.
Installation time was significantly reduced through the use of Gypsol ZL, with the full installation completed in 1 hour and 20 minutes. The efficient process delivered immediate cost savings, while the enhanced thermal performance of Gypsol screed is expected to generate ongoing energy cost savings over the lifetime of the property through faster and more efficient heat transfer.
Key benefits of using ZL
Gypsol ZL screed combines LKAB Gypsol binder, sand, and water. With a binder made from 98% by-product, ZL achieves an 88% reduction in carbon emissions versus alternative screeds.
Key benefits achieved included:
- Significantly reduced installation time due to the flowing screed system
- With no laitance present, Gypsol ZL screed allows faster drying and hydration, enabling earlier installation of the final floor finishes
- Improved heat transfer performance, supporting the efficiency of the ASHP and UFH system
- Reduced labour and programme costs
Over the lifetime of the property, the enhanced thermal performance of Gypsol screed is expected to deliver considerable energy savings.
